It is suggested that absorption in the 0.32-0.5 micron range in the upper part of the Venus cloud layer is due to NH3-SO2, formed as a result of the reaction between NH3 and SO2 in the gas phase. The conditions of formation of the NH3-SO2 are investigated, and attention is given to the implications of this reaction for the upper part of the Venus cloud layer.
